Yield: 4 servings
Ingredients:
- 1 medium sized cantaloupe
- Juice of half a lemon
- 2 tsp honey
- 1 mango
Instructions:
- Peel and seed cantaloupe.
- Cut into 1-inch pieces (should be about 6 cups).
- Place in blender or food processor with lemon juice and honey and puree until very smooth.
- Pour mixture into shallow 9x12" glass pan and set in freezer for 2 hours.
- With a fork, chip and stir the icy mixture and return it to the freezer for 2-4 more hours.
- Peal and cut mango into long, thin slices.
- Remove frozen cantaloupe mixture from freezer and chip it with a fork until it resembles shaved ice.
- Spoon into four bowls, top with mango slices, and serve.
Nutrition Information: 90 calories, 0 grams total fat, 23 grams carbohydrate, 1 gram protein, 2 grams fiber, 25 milligrams sodium, 0 milligrams cholesterol.
